When J Smith officiates Luton matches, the statistics reveal no significant bias pattern. Based on 10 matches spanning multiple seasons, our comprehensive analysis shows Luton achieves a 40% win rate under J Smith, compared to the 45% baseline expected for teams at this level. This negative 5.0 percentage point difference falls within normal statistical variance.
